Ingredients

Chicken and Breading
- 1.5 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1 cup flour
- 2 eggs, beaten
- 1 cup breadcrumbs
- Olive oil spray
Cowboy Butter Sauce
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
- 1/4 cup fresh parsley, finely chopped
- 1/2 tsp red pepper flakes
- 1 tbsp Dijon mustard
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tbsp lemon juice
- 1/2 tsp smoked paprika
Instructions
-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and spray with olive oil spray to prevent sticking.
- Season Chicken: Season the bite-sized chicken pieces evenly with salt and black pepper.
- Prepare Breading Station: Set up three separate dishes: one filled with flour, one with beaten eggs, and one with breadcrumbs for breading the chicken.
- Bread the Chicken: Dip each chicken piece first into the flour, shaking off excess, then coat in the beaten eggs, and finally press into the breadcrumbs to ensure a firm coating.
- Arrange on Baking Sheet: Place the breaded chicken pieces onto the prepared baking sheet spaced evenly. Lightly spray the tops with olive oil spray for crispiness.
- Bake the Chicken: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the chicken pieces turn golden brown and are cooked through with an internal temperature of 165°F.
- Make Cowboy Butter: While the chicken is baking, mix together the melted butter, finely chopped parsley, red pepper flakes, Dijon mustard, minced garlic, lemon juice, and smoked paprika in a medium bowl until well combined.
- Toss Chicken in Sauce: Once baked, immediately transfer the chicken bites to the bowl with the cowboy butter and toss thoroughly to coat each piece with the flavorful sauce.
- Serve: Serve the chicken bites hot, accompanied by extra cowboy butter sauce for dipping if desired.
Notes
- Ensure chicken pieces are uniformly sized for even cooking.
- For extra crispiness, swap regular breadcrumbs with panko breadcrumbs.
- Adjust red pepper flakes based on your preferred spice level.
- Use fresh lemon juice for the best zesty flavor.
- Leftover cowboy butter makes a great dipping sauce or spread.
